Linda A. Rymarquis is a scholar working on Molecular Biology, Plant Science and Cellular and Molecular Neuroscience. According to data from OpenAlex, Linda A. Rymarquis has authored 18 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Molecular Biology, 13 papers in Plant Science and 1 paper in Cellular and Molecular Neuroscience. Recurrent topics in Linda A. Rymarquis’s work include Chromosomal and Genetic Variations (9 papers), Plant Molecular Biology Research (8 papers) and CRISPR and Genetic Engineering (5 papers). Linda A. Rymarquis is often cited by papers focused on Chromosomal and Genetic Variations (9 papers), Plant Molecular Biology Research (8 papers) and CRISPR and Genetic Engineering (5 papers). Linda A. Rymarquis collaborates with scholars based in United States, India and Mexico. Linda A. Rymarquis's co-authors include Pamela J. Green, Blake C. Meyers, Dong‐Hoon Jeong, Emanuele De Paoli, Marcelo A. German, Gary P. Schroth, Shujun Luo, Kan Nobuta, Manoj Pillay and Cheng Lu and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Nucleic Acids Research and Nature Communications.
